当前位置:首页 > 前端开发 > 正文内容

vue网页,什么是Vue.js?

admin3周前 (01-11)前端开发4

关于Vue网页开发,这里有一些详细的资源和教程,可以帮助你快速上手和深入理解Vue.js框架:

1. 快速上手 Vue.js: Vue.js官方文档提供了详细的快速上手指南,介绍如何在本地搭建Vue单页应用。你可以通过运行`createvue`命令来创建项目,并选择是否添加TypeScript和JSX支持等选项。

2. Vue.js 教程 | 菜鸟教程: 菜鸟教程提供了Vue.js的基础教程,介绍了Vue.js的渐进式开发模式,并详细讲解了如何实现响应的数据绑定和组合的视图组件。

3. 搭建一个简单Vue项目web项目全过程: 这篇文章详细介绍了使用Vue CLI创建Vue项目,安装必要的依赖(如vuerouter和vuex),以及设计前端页面和组件的过程。

4. 开始使用 Vue 学习 Web 开发 | MDN: MDN的教程介绍了Vue的背景知识,如何安装和创建新项目,研究项目和组件的结构,并在本地运行项目。

5. Vue.js 教程: Vue.js官方教程提供了一个交互式的学习环境,你可以通过编辑代码并立即看到结果来体验Vue的核心功能。

6. Vue新手快速入门指南: 这篇博客文章旨在帮助初学者快速上手Vue框架,理解其核心概念,并逐步构建一个简单的Vue应用。

7. Vue.js 渐进式JavaScript框架: Vue.js的官方文档详细介绍了Vue.js的易学易用性、性能以及丰富的生态系统,适用于构建用户界面。

8. Vue.js 实例 菜鸟教程: 菜鸟教程提供了几个Vue.js实例,通过实例练习来巩固学到的知识点。

9. 适合初学者练手的Vue小项目: 这篇博客文章提供了一些适合初学者练习的Vue小项目,通过实践这些项目可以提升Vue技能。

10. Vue快速入门(附实战小项目): 这篇文章提供了Vue快速入门指南,并附带了几个实战小项目,如记事本、天气预报和音乐播放器。

希望这些资源能够帮助你更好地学习和使用Vue.js框架进行网页开发。

Vue.js:引领前端开发的革命性框架

什么是Vue.js?

Vue.js,简称Vue,是一款流行的前端JavaScript框架,由尤雨溪(Evan You)于2014年创建。Vue的设计理念是渐进式,这意味着开发者可以根据项目的需求逐步引入Vue的特性,而不是一次性引入所有功能。Vue的核心库只关注视图层,易于上手,同时提供了高效的数据绑定和组合的视图组件系统。

Vue.js的特点

Vue.js具有以下特点,使其成为前端开发者的首选框架:

响应式数据绑定:Vue.js通过响应式系统,自动追踪依赖关系,当数据变化时,视图会自动更新,反之亦然。

组件化开发:Vue.js支持组件化开发,可以将应用拆分成可复用的组件,提高开发效率和代码的可维护性。

简洁的语法:Vue.js的语法简洁明了,易于学习和使用。

双向数据绑定:Vue.js提供了双向数据绑定,使得数据模型和视图之间的同步变得简单。

虚拟DOM:Vue.js使用虚拟DOM来优化DOM操作,提高页面渲染性能。

Vue.js的安装与配置

要开始使用Vue.js,首先需要安装Node.js和npm(Node.js包管理器)。可以通过以下步骤创建一个Vue.js项目:

全局安装Vue CLI(Vue.js命令行工具):

npm install -g @vue/cli

创建一个新的Vue.js项目:

vue create my-vue-project

进入项目目录并启动开发服务器:

cd my-vue-project

npm run serve

这样,你就可以在浏览器中访问

分享给朋友:

“vue网页,什么是Vue.js?” 的相关文章

css命名, CSS 命名规范的重要性

1. 有意义:选择器或类的名称应该描述它们所应用的元素或内容。例如,`.mainheader` 或 `.buttonsubmit`。2. 简洁:避免使用过于冗长的名称,但也要确保它们足够描述性。例如,`.navbar` 而不是 `.navigationbar`。3. 一致:在项目中保持一致的命名约定...

html写表格,```html    HTML 表格示例

html写表格,```html HTML 表格示例

当然可以。HTML(超文本标记语言)是用于创建网页的标准标记语言。在HTML中,您可以使用``元素来创建表格。以下是一个基本的HTML表格示例:```html HTML 表格示例简单的 HTML 表格 姓名 年龄 职业...

css文本超出省略号

css文本超出省略号

在CSS中,要实现文本超出显示省略号的效果,可以使用以下代码:```css.textoverflow { whitespace: nowrap; / 不换行 / overflow: hidden; / 超出部分隐藏 / textoverflow: ellipsis; / 文字超出部分显示省略号...

html课程表代码

html课程表代码

创建一个HTML课程表通常涉及到使用表格(``)元素来组织数据。下面是一个简单的HTML课程表示例,展示了如何使用``、``(行)、``(表头)和``(单元格)来构建课程表:```html课程表 table { width: 100%; bordercollapse: collapse...

jquery复制,```htmlClone Element Example

jquery复制,```htmlClone Element Example

在jQuery中,你可以使用`.clone`方法来复制DOM元素。这个方法可以创建被选元素的副本,包括其子节点、文本和属性。如果你还需要复制元素的事件处理程序,可以传递参数`true`给`.clone`方法。 语法```javascript$.cloneqwe2``` `withDataAndEve...

react路由, 什么是React路由?

react路由, 什么是React路由?

React 路由是用于构建单页应用(SPA)的关键技术,它允许你根据不同的 URL 显示不同的组件。React Router 是最流行的 React 路由库,它提供了声明式路由的解决方案,使得用户在浏览网站时,无需重新加载整个页面,只需更新页面的特定部分。 React Router 的主要特点:1....